Empowering Women in Umpiring: Webinar for Female Match Officials

For the first time in European table tennis, a women-only webinar will be held to celebrate and empower female match officials. The online session, titled “Empowering Women in Umpiring: Breaking Barriers and Finding Balance”, is designed to support and inspire women who are curious about umpiring or already part of the officiating community.

This event is open to all women interested in or currently engaged with umpiring, especially those who may be wondering what it’s like to step into the role, how to advance in the field, and how to manage the balance between travel, career, and personal life.

The webinar will feature real stories from female umpires at different stages of life and career. From those just beginning their international journey, to veterans who have officiated at the Olympic Games, and now mentor the next generation — each speaker brings invaluable insight and experience.

What makes this event truly special is its exclusive, women-only format. This creates a safe and open space for participants to ask questions, even the uncomfortable ones, knowing that they are speaking to others who understand the challenges and experiences unique to women in the field.

  • Balanced Focus: Explore how to thrive as an umpire while balancing family, work, and personal time.
  • Interactive & Real: Engage with relatable stories and get practical advice based on real-life situations.
  • Empowering & Motivating: Be inspired to pursue or continue your path in umpiring, with reassurance that it can coexist with other life responsibilities.

Whether you’re considering becoming a match official or already on that path, this webinar is an opportunity to connect, learn, and grow — together with other women who share your passion.

The European Table Tennis Union (ETTU) is the governing body of the sport of table tennis in Europe, and is the only authority recognized for this purpose by the International Table Tennis Federation. The ETTU deals with all matters relating to table tennis at a European level, including the development and promotion of the sport in the territories controlled by its 58 member associations, and the organization of continental table tennis competitions, including the European Championships.
